Background
The Idaho Transportation Department (ITD) is responsible for maintaining and operating approximately 12,300 lane miles of state highways. During winter months, snow and ice accumulate on highways, creating hazardous conditions. To mitigate these hazards, ITD utilizes plow and brine trucks that require a substantial amount of brine solution for effective operation. This solicitation seeks bids from qualified vendors for the purchase and delivery of Polyethylene Bulk Liquid Storage Tanks to store the brine solution necessary for maintaining safe road conditions.

Work Details
The contract involves the supply and delivery of Norwesco #47638 ten-thousand five-hundred (10,500) vertical translucent white polyethylene gallon tanks or equivalent. The tanks must meet the following specifications:

- High-density vertical translucent white poly tanks with an overall height of 130 inches (+/- 10%)
- Overall diameter of 202 inches (+/- 10%)
- Four lifting lugs
- Embossed date stamp in month/year format
- Embossed gallon measurement markers
- Self-supporting design requiring no framework
- UV resistant material suitable for storing salt brine solution with a minimum specific gravity of 1.6

The tanks must include:

- A minimum 16-inch offset top fill vented access port lid
- Vent fitting at the top
- Flat areas for valve installation
- Tie down points for secure mounting
- Two installed 3-inch flange fittings at the lowest level for complete draining.

Period of Performance
Delivery is expected within 90 days after receipt of order (ARO). The contractor must deliver and unload the tanks within 120 calendar days after receipt of each order.

Place of Performance
Delivery locations include ITD District 1 Osburn Yard in Osburn, ID; ITD District 3 Yard in Boise, ID; and ITD District 6 Yard in Rigby, ID.

Bidder Requirements
Bidders must be authorized distributors or manufacturers of the tanks offered. They are required to provide certificates of insurance within five days of notification of award. Insurance must include Commercial General Liability with a limit of not less than $1 million per occurrence and Workers Compensation Insurance as per Idaho regulations.
